Job Summary
Operates material handler (grapple/magnet), front end loader and forklift to assist unloading customers and load trailers to prepare for transport of scrap materials. Inspects incoming material and grades accordingly.
Operates straight or articulated rubber-tired tractor type vehicle equipped with front mounted hydraulic powered bucket or forks to lift and transport bulk material to and from storage or processing areas.
Primary Responsibilities
- Load and unload customer’s trucks/vehicles.
- Performs routine maintenance on loader such as lubricating, fueling, and cleaning.
- Completes inspection report prior to using equipment.
- Perform and maintain general housekeeping.
- Responsible for customer and employee safety in and around work area.
- Other duties as assigned.
